The large footswitch provides convenient hands-free operation.
Tap the footswitch once to begin recording.
Tap the footswitch once to play the recorded loop.
Tap the footswitch again to add another layer to the existing loop.
Press and hold the footswitch during the appropriate recording/overdub operation to undo or redo the latest overdub.
Double-tap the footswitch to stop playback or recording.
Press and hold the footswitch while stopped to delete the current loop.
This intuitive control system makes it easy to operate the pedal while concentrating on your playing.

Brand: LEKATO
Product Type: Guitar Effect Pedal / Looper Station
Model: Guitar Looper with Tuner
Material: Zinc Alloy
Loop Slots: 9
Total Recording Time: Up to 40 minutes
Maximum Single Track: Up to 10 minutes
Audio Format: WAV
Bypass: True Bypass
Tuner: Built-in
USB: Yes
Computer Support: Windows / Mac OS
Input: 1/4" Mono Audio Jack
Output: 1/4" Mono Audio Jack
Power Supply: DC 9V Centre Negative
Power Adapter: Not Included
Pedal Dimensions: 90 × 40 × 49.5 mm
Pedal Weight: Approximately 199 g
Origin: Mainland China
